Kenton Paulino Update

Kenton Paulino, a slick 6-2 shooting/combo guard from Maine Central Institute in Pittsfield, Me., has gotten a qualifying SAT score.
Paulino came to MCI after prepping at Fremont H.S. in Los Angeles so that he could boost his academic credentials.

His play this past summer with the H-Squad program sparked high major recruiting interest from programs like Seton Hall and Providence, although Paulino opted to sign with Texas after visiting the Big 12 program in the fall.
Henrikson said that Paulino scored a 950 on the SAT, meaning that he should be eligible next fall for the Longhorns.
Paulino is a gifted offensive player who can create off the dribble. He is blessed with good quickness and uses his handle to create separation from defenders for open looks.
While his offensive game is more refined, Paulino throws good outlet passes to start the break and can play some point. He can also finish with either hand around the rim.
